Output 24bdb5d078050761f199f4331c2a2e1d3b53b32ef145019c4e0fc3ad20d02453:1

value
22955605
script pubkey
OP_0 OP_PUSHBYTES_20 1afc2c6c93f51d1b8c2e3c44bd7db6612b4ab506
address
bc1qrt7zcmyn75w3hrpw83zt6ldkvy454dgxpwhths
transaction
24bdb5d078050761f199f4331c2a2e1d3b53b32ef145019c4e0fc3ad20d02453